Arabella Kennedy 1956 - 1956

Arabella Kennedy was born on August 23, 1956 at Newport, Newport, Rhode Island, United States to John F. Kennedy and Jacqueline Kennedy Onassis, and had siblings John F. Kennedy Jr., Caroline Bouvier Kennedy, and Patrick Bouvier Kennedy. Arabella Kennedy died on August 23, 1956 at Newport, Newport, Rhode Island, United States, and was buried circa September 1956 at Arlington National Cemetary in USA.
